Sony Walkman - Image 1With the current popularity of video and music players, it's no surprise the Sony updated their Walkman line with a new series of products that not only play music, but support video as well. Introducing the NWZ-A810 and NWZ-S610, two new products that not only perform well, but also looks pleasing to the eye.

Both Walkman players have LCD screens with a resolution of 320x240 pixels, and their Quarter Video Graphics Array (QVGA) enables the video music players to display videos at 30 frames per second.

The  NWZ-A810 and NWZ-S610 supports open standard media, so there shouldn't be any problems in playing media encoded in most format. Should there be any need to convert media, you can use shareware to convert the video clips or music.

Battery life isn't going to be an issue as well since the NWZ-A810 series sport a hefty battery life of eight hours, while NWZ-S610 can last for up to nine-and-a-half hours. Pretty useful for those who travel in long stretches at a time.

NWZ-A810 players come in three flavors: 2GB, 4GB and 8GB. All of the devices come in white, pink, black and silver, with the exception of the 8GB player which only comes in black or silver colors. Pricing for this player are as follows: US$ 140 for 2GB, US$ 180 for 4GB, and US$ 230 for 8GB.

On the other hand, the NWZ-S610 comes also in the same flavors as the above device. Available colors are black, pink, red and silver, again with the exception of the 8GB flavor that only comes in black. Prices for this device are US$ 120 for 2GB, US$ 160 for 4GB, and US$ 210 for 8GB.
